Parameters
Access.
/Envelope /Body /AirShoppingRQ /Party /Sender /AgentUserSender
Include Page | ||||
---|---|---|---|---|
|
Corporate Program credentials.
/Envelope /Body /FlightPriceRQ/Qualifiers /Qualifier /SpecialFareQualifiers
Include Page | ||||
---|---|---|---|---|
|
# | Description | Mand | Mult | Default | Ref/Format | xPath | Example (only for S7) |
---|---|---|---|---|---|---|---|
1 | IATA airline code | for Corporate Program case for other cases | Constant | AirlineID="S7" | <AirlineID>S7</AirlineID> | ||
2 | Client ID | for Corporate Program case for other cases | CompanyIndex | <CompanyIndex>QUW0000</CompanyIndex> or <CompanyIndex>QY0000</CompanyIndex> | |||
3 | Agent ID | for Corporate Program case for other cases | Account | <Account>12251</Account> |
Main.
/Envelope /Body /FlightPriceRQ
# | Description | Mand | Mult | Default | Ref/Format/Desc | xPath | Example |
---|---|---|---|---|---|---|---|
1 | Currency | RUB | IATA currency code | Parameters /CurrCodes /CurrCode | <CurrCodes> | ||
2 | Result Type | BrandedFares |
| Parameters /ServiceFilters /ServiceFilter[GroupCode="FareOut"] /SubGroupCode for Include Baggage | <ServiceFilter> for Include Baggage <ServiceFilter> | ||
3 | Sorting |
| Parameters /ServiceFilters /ServiceFilter[GroupCode="Sort"] /SubGroupCode | <ServiceFilter> | |||
4 | Traveler | Traveler types details | Travalers /Traveler | <Traveler> | |||
5 | Itinerary details | CoreQuery /OriginDestinations /OriginDestination | <OriginDestination> | ||||
6 | Aircraft Cabin | Returns both cabin types |
| Preferences /Preference /FlightPreferences /Aircraft /Cabins /Cabin /Code | <Cabin> | ||
7 | Flight types | Returns all itineraries: direct, transit and transfer |
| Preferences /Preference /FlightPreferences /Characteristic /DirectPreferences | <FlightPreferences> |
AnchorTraveler Traveler
Traveler.
/Envelope /Body /FlightPriceRQ/Travelers /Traveler (Multiple)
Traveler | |
Traveler |
# | Description | Mand | Mult | Default | Ref/Format/Desc | xPath | Example |
---|---|---|---|---|---|---|---|
1 | Passenger Type Code |
| AnonymousTraveler /PTC | <PTC Quantity="1">ADT</PTC> | |||
2 | Passenger Quantity |
| AnonymousTraveler /PTC /@Quantity | <PTC Quantity="2">CHD</PTC> |
Anchor | ||||
---|---|---|---|---|
|
/Envelope /Body /FlightPriceRQ/CoreQuery /OriginDestinations /OriginDestination/Flight(Multiple)
# | Description | Mand | Mult | Default | Ref/Format/Desc | xPath | Example |
---|---|---|---|---|---|---|---|
1 | Departure IATA airport or city code | IATA airpot/city code | Departure /AirportCode | <AirportCode>OVB</AirportCode> | |||
2 | Departure Date | YYYY-MM-DD | Departure /Date | <Date>2017-07-20</Date> | |||
3 | Arrival IATA airport or city code | IATA airpot/city code | Arrival /AirportCode | <AirportCode>DME</AirportCode> | |||
4 | Arrival Date | YYYY-MM-DD | Arrival /Date | <Date>2017-07-20</Date> | |||
5 | Marketing Carrier | Marketing carrier IATA airline code Marketing carrier flight number | MarketingCarrier/AirlineID
| <AirlineID>S7</AirlineID> <FlightNumber>2502</FlightNumber> | |||
6 | ClassOfService | Letter (RBD) Fare code | ClassOfService/ ClassOfService/MarketingName |
|